Chimerism MonitoringChimerism Monitoring• Function of graft• Prediction of negative events .

– Disease relapse– Graft rejection.– Graft-versus-host disease.

The quantitative estimation of the proportion of donor versus recipient

cells in the patient is related to as the percent of mixed chimerism.

Page 28: Quantification of Post-transplantation Chimerism:  Algorithm for Correcting Systematic Errors

Materials & MethodsMaterials & Methods

• DNA Extraction from patient's blood cells.

• PCR amplification of STR markers.

• Sequencing of the amplified products.

• Sequencer output analysis using the ABI Genescan program.
